Installing controller in airplane

Filed under: Senior Project — von der Lord Larry @ 11:34 pm

Sam and I spent 5 hours yesterday installing all of the electronics in the airplane. We also fixed the muffler, which had been coming loose. We checked the balance, and it is just about right. It may be a bit nose-heavy, which means we might be able to remove some of the lead weights from the nose.

Next weekend is the last chance I’ll have to fly it before my presentation. I think I might be able to get it ready to fly by then. It is already setup to collect flight data, but not quite ready to control the airplane on its own. Right now there are two receivers onboard: one for control, and the other for data logging. I think I need to solder a longer antenna on the modified receiver before I trust it with the airplane.

I think my flight control software might be sending sevo command updates to frequently. I’m not sure, but it seems like the servo controller is missing some of the signals. I might have to slow the flight software main loop down, or at least slow the servo update down.

Also, the flight computer is missing about 1/4 of the IMU signals due to buffer overruns. This means that I either need to speed main loop execution somehow, or that I need to reduce the IMU output frequency.
